Can you eat Provolone cheese when Pregnant?

Provolone cheese is generally considered safe to eat during pregnancy, but there are some considerations to keep in mind:

Check for Pasteurization: It's recommended to choose Provolone cheese made from pasteurized milk. Pasteurization involves heating the milk to eliminate harmful bacteria, including Listeria, which can pose a risk to pregnant women.

Opt for Processed Provolone: Processed cheese slices or pre-packaged Provolone cheese from reputable sources are often made with pasteurized milk. These can be a safer choice during pregnancy.

Monitor Portion Sizes: As with any food, it's essential to consume Provolone cheese in moderation. Pay attention to portion sizes to ensure a balanced diet.

Avoid Unpasteurized Varieties: If you are unsure about the pasteurization status of a particular Provolone cheese or if you are considering a variety that might be made from unpasteurized milk, it's advisable to avoid it during pregnancy to reduce the risk of foodborne illnesses.

As with any dietary concerns during pregnancy, it's recommended to consult with a healthcare professional for personalized advice based on your individual health and circumstances.
